May 2025 - Apr 2026Sheldon Way area has the 4th highest crime rate of 74 local areas in Birling, Leybourne & Ryarsh , and the 22nd highest crime rate of 401 local areas in Tonbridge and Malling .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Sheldon Way (ME20 6SE) in the last 12 months was 196.9 per 1,000 residents and was 482.0% higher than the Birling, Leybourne & Ryarsh average (33.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 22 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 21 (≈ 65.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 31.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-31.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Sheldon Way (ME20 6SE), the main crime hotspot is near New Hythe Lane. Police recorded 46 crimes here, including 17 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
